Interactive Traffic Management Simulator

A complete TMP workbench built on Unreal Engine. Design the traffic management plan, run realistic AI traffic through it, walk it as a pedestrian or drive it in VR, then export the flythroughs — one tool, end to end.

[ aerial view — full TMP with live AI traffic at dusk ]
// THE CHALLENGE

Traffic Management Plans are traditionally designed in 2D CAD, risk-assessed on paper, and communicated through static drawings. The first time anyone experiences the plan as a road user is when the cones are already on the ground — exactly when changes are most expensive and most dangerous to make.

Testing a TMP against real traffic behaviour — vehicle classes, flow rates, peak conditions, pedestrian movement — simply isn't possible in the tools TMPs are usually drawn in.

// WHAT WE BUILT

We built a purpose-designed simulator on Unreal Engine where a TMP can be designed, built and risk-assessed inside one tool. Real project context comes in two ways: direct import of common AEC formats (OBJ, FBX, NWD), or real-world context streamed live through built-in ArcGIS connectivity.

Custom road-building tools replicate the existing road environment, and a bespoke TMP toolset lays out the plan itself — signage, barriers, closures and diversions — exactly as it would be deployed on the day.

// KEY CAPABILITIES
Design the TMP in-tool

A bespoke suite of tools to design, build or replicate a Traffic Management Plan directly inside the simulator — plus custom road-building tools to match existing road and traffic conditions.

Real project context

Import design and context models via common AEC formats (OBJ, FBX, NWD) — or stream real-world GIS context straight in through built-in ArcGIS connectivity.

Realistic traffic simulation

AI-driven vehicles with real-world physics and turning circles — across configurable vehicle classes, flow rates, times of day and weather conditions — to test the TMP's impact on road users.

Pedestrian safety simulation

Simulate walkways and pedestrian movement alongside traffic, confirming the design doesn't create unforeseen risk for road users or pedestrians.

VR & driving hardware

Experience the plan from a pedestrian's or driver's perspective in VR — compatible with all major headsets, and with Logitech steering wheel and pedal hardware for driver-seat review.

Presentation-ready output

TMP flythroughs, animations and renders exported directly from the tool for submissions, briefings and stakeholder reviews.

// OUTCOMES
TMPs designed, tested and risk-assessed in a single tool — no round-trips between CAD, simulation and presentation software
Driver and pedestrian risks surfaced virtually, before anything is deployed on a live road
Stakeholders review the plan from the road user's perspective — in VR or behind the wheel — instead of a plan-view drawing
Flythroughs, animations and renders produced straight from the tool
